Number: 132994100
Country: Philippines
Source: Philippine Goverment Electronic Procurement system
Number: 128405659
Number: 128405718
Number: 126020568
Number: 126020629
Number: 112172600
Number: 1126416
Country: China
Source: CCGP
Number: 1126417
Number: 1126418
Number: 1126419
Number: 1126420
Number: 1126421